Hoping everyone is having a great summer. The summer months are very hard for us because food and monetary donations are at a low. We ask that you take a look at our “How You Can Help” section and if possible donate in anyway you can.


Every 3rd Thursday of the month we get our USDA delivery from the Foodbank of Monmouth and Ocean Counties and are always looking for volunteers for an hour or two (1-2) to help us unload the truck.  If you are capable of lifting we can surely use your help.  Please contact the pantry for more information.
